MEEN 457 - Flight Vehicle Stability/Contr

Institution:
Southern University and A & M College
Subject:
Mechanical Engineering
Description:
Airplane maneuvering is accomplished by changing forces and moments produced by wings and horizontal and vertical tail sections. Control of flight vehicles therefore becomes very challenging for the designers and pilots as well. MEEN 457 teaches students the fundamentals of aerospace feedback control theory, integration of airplane stability matrices and analysis of nonlinear equations of motion, trajectory analysis under various initial conditions, and modes of instability encountered during such motion. Prerequisites: MEEN 271 and 374.
